Raspberry Pi 40-pin LCD module
This 4 inch square LCD connects directly to the Raspberry Pi 40-pin GPIO header. It is designed for makers building compact IoT edge devices or development boards. The panel uses the DPI666 interface to deliver a 720×720 IPS image at up to 60Hz refresh rate.
Capacitive touch and OS support
Five-point capacitive touch input is handled through the Pi I2C interface, adding interactive control without extra wiring. The display works with Raspbian, Kali and Ubuntu MATE, so existing Pi software stacks run without modification.
720×720 panel capacity
The 720×720 resolution suits dashboard readouts, portable GUIs and camera previews in a small footprint. The 60Hz ceiling covers smooth UI animation but leaves no headroom for high-frame-rate video or fast gaming workloads.
